DependencyResolver Clase
Definición
Importante
Parte de la información hace referencia a la versión preliminar del producto, que puede haberse modificado sustancialmente antes de lanzar la versión definitiva. Microsoft no otorga ninguna garantía, explícita o implícita, con respecto a la información proporcionada aquí.
Proporciona un punto de registro para los solucionadores de dependencias que implementan IDependencyResolver o la interfaz IServiceLocator del localizador de servicios comunes.
public class DependencyResolver
type DependencyResolver = class
Public Class DependencyResolver
- Herencia
-
DependencyResolver
Constructores
DependencyResolver() |
Inicializa una nueva instancia de la clase DependencyResolver. |
Propiedades
Current |
Obtiene la implementación de la resolución de dependencia. |
InnerCurrent |
Esta API admite la infraestructura de ASP.NET MVC y no está previsto su uso directo desde el código. |
Métodos
InnerSetResolver(Func<Type,Object>, Func<Type,IEnumerable<Object>>) |
Esta API admite la infraestructura de ASP.NET MVC y no está previsto su uso directo desde el código. |
InnerSetResolver(IDependencyResolver) |
Esta API admite la infraestructura de ASP.NET MVC y no está previsto su uso directo desde el código. |
InnerSetResolver(Object) |
Esta API admite la infraestructura de ASP.NET MVC y no está previsto su uso directo desde el código. |
SetResolver(Func<Type,Object>, Func<Type,IEnumerable<Object>>) |
Proporciona un punto de registro para las resoluciones de dependencia mediante el delegado de servicio especificado y los delegados de colección de servicios especificados. |
SetResolver(IDependencyResolver) |
Proporciona un punto de registro para las resoluciones de dependencia mediante la interfaz de resolución de dependencia especificada. |
SetResolver(Object) |
Proporciona un punto de registro para las resoluciones de dependencia mediante el localizador de servicios común proporcionado cuando se usa una interfaz de localizador de servicios. |